Program overview

The Master of Data Science is built for professionals and advanced graduates who want strong capability in analytics, machine learning, and data-driven decision systems.

Students study statistical modeling, machine learning, data engineering, visualization, and responsible AI while completing applied projects that reflect current institutional and industry data challenges.

Outcomes

Expected outcomes

Design end-to-end analytical workflows from data preparation to insight delivery
Build and evaluate machine learning models for applied decision contexts
Communicate analytical findings to technical and non-technical audiences
Apply ethical and responsible practices in modern AI and data systems

Program components

Core Analytical Foundations

The first term strengthens statistical thinking, data programming, and applied modeling foundations.

  • Advanced statistics and inference
  • Programming for analytics workflows
  • Structured analytical reasoning

Machine Learning and Predictive Systems

Students build supervised and unsupervised learning capabilities while evaluating model fit, bias, and performance.

  • Machine learning methods
  • Model evaluation and validation
  • Applied predictive problem solving

Data Engineering and Decision Platforms

This stage covers data pipelines, warehousing concepts, visualization, and decision support infrastructure.

  • Data engineering and pipeline design
  • Visualization and storytelling
  • Analytics products and dashboards

Applied Research and Capstone

The final stage combines research, domain application, and presentation of a substantial data project.

  • Research methods for data science
  • Applied capstone or dissertation
  • Professional presentation and impact reporting
Participation

Participation guidance

Applicants should hold a relevant undergraduate qualification and demonstrate readiness for advanced quantitative and computational study.

  • Relevant bachelor degree in computing, mathematics, engineering, or a related field
  • Evidence of analytical and quantitative readiness
  • Professional experience with data is an advantage but not mandatory
